Cromwell and Scanlon are places in Minnesota.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

Scanlon has the higher population (1,087 vs 379 in Cromwell). Scanlon has the higher median household income ($75,833 vs $55,625 in Cromwell). Scanlon has the higher median home value ($221,500 vs $150,000 in Cromwell).
